Apparently I sleep well in the islands! Slept almost 9 hours without waking up. Had breakfast on the veranda and chose our first beach--Maho.
Stopped at Deli Grotto to get sandwiches. Oh, the Pink Cadillac was wonderful--turkey, cheese, cream cheese, guacamole and salsa on pumperknickel. I had a second one later in the week.
We arrived at Maho at 8:30. It's a little unnerving to be the only ones on the beach on the first day out, but a few more people eventually showed. We snorkeled along the rocks to the right. Came back in to rest. Went out again and went around the rocks to what I think was Little Maho and back.
Both times out, I forgot the camera. I don't normally even take photos, Greg does, and I've never taken underwater photos before, so it didn't come naturally to me. Of course, Greg was no where to be found and I didn't have the camera when I saw the stingray, but I saw it! Finally, after lunch, I went out a third time and remembered the camera.
I liked my new Olympus 850, but I had a heck of a time seeing things in the LCD screen underwater. I have lots of pictures of fish tails. Most of the time I was shooting blind and hoping something was in the frame. As you can see, I shot mostly rock here.

Left the beach and drove over to see Coral Bay. Stopped at the Smoothie truck for a delicious smoothie, and went back to the house to hang out. Great day so far!
Then I looked outside and noticed that the left front tire on the Nitro was totally flat! Greg told me to call St John Car Rental and see what we should do. My mistake was asking if Greg should put the spare on or if they wanted to come out to do it. Guess which option they picked? Greg had a really hard time with the slope of the driveway/parking area and the height of the jack. He got the tire off and then couldn't get the spare on. So he puts the tire back on and moves the car, twice, before he can get enough room to put the spare on. I had told the guy at STJ Car Rental that we'd put the spare on and be right in. I asked and he said they'd be there until 5:00. Well, island time meant that they closed before 4:45 when we got there. He said that everyone was gone for the day, so come back tomorrow at 8:00AM.
We shopped a bit at Wharfside and then headed over to the Lime Inn for shrimp night. Greg and Layne gorged themselves on shrimp while I had the grilled Caribbean lobster.
Went back to the house, had some coconut ice cream and crashed early again. Snorkeling and sun wears me out!
Day 3 began about 3:00 AM when I heard rain on the roof. Wow, rain on a metal roof is loud, but I soon fell back asleep.
Packed up our beach gear and headed into STJ Car rental for them to patch the tire. I don't know which made me more nervous driving on the those roads with a spare or a patched tire. It held though, and that was the last of the car trouble for the week.
It was a non-cruise day so we headed to Trunk. Not too crowded at 9:30 when we arrived so we found a shady spot up under the trees and settled in. Greg and I both did the underwater trail. Layne wasn't too thrilled with snorkeling so she sat and read.
